Knight Adds to USA Truck Stake, Answers Lawsuit

Knight Transportation Inc. raised its stake in takeover-target USA Truck Inc. to 12.4% and denied breach- of-contract allegations.

Knight, based in Phoenix, increased its stake from 11%, according to a regulatory filing made Oct. 15 with the Securities and Exchange Commission. That move followed an Oct. 11 denial by Knight that it had used confidential information in preparing its $9 per share offer for USA Truck.

USA Truck has rejected the offer, saying the company鈥檚 value is much higher.

USA Truck on Oct. 10 filed the suit in Circuit Court of Crawford County in Van Buren, Ark., its headquarters city.
